Esempio n. 1
0
        private void SetupRegisterSet()
        {
            CpuRegisterSet registerSet = m_cpu.RegisterSet;

            registerSet.Reset();
            registerSet.PR.Value = StartAddress.GetValueAsWord();
        }
        public void TestInitialize()
        {
            m_registerSet = new CpuRegisterSet();
            m_memory      = new Memory();
            m_logger      = new TestLogger();

            CpuInstruction.ReturningFromSubroutine += OnReturningFromSubroutine;
            CpuInstruction.CallingSuperVisor       += OnCallingSuperVisor;
        }
Esempio n. 3
0
        public void TestInitialize()
        {
            m_registerSet = new CpuRegisterSet();
            m_memory      = new Memory();
            m_gr          = m_registerSet.GR[1];
            m_pr          = m_registerSet.PR;
            m_fr          = m_registerSet.FR;
            m_logger      = new TestLogger();

            Operator.ReturningFromSubroutine += OnReturningFromSubroutine;
            Operator.CallingSuperVisor       += OnCallingSuperVisor;
        }
 public void TestInitialize()
 {
     m_registerSet = new CpuRegisterSet();
     m_memory      = new Memory();
 }
 public void TestInitialize()
 {
     m_registerSet = new CpuRegisterSet();
 }